Report: Saints could sign Adrian Peterson ‘down the line’

Adrian Peterson visited with the New Orleans Saints earlier this week, and it sounds like the meeting went well enough that the two sides are open to working out some sort of deal — eventually.

Nick Underhill of The Advocate confirmed on Friday that Peterson left New Orleans without a contract. However, the belief is that the two sides have not closed the door on a possible agreement, though it would likely come “down the line” at some point. That probably means after the NFL Draft.

As expected, Underhill implied that money could be an issue with Peterson and the Saints. New Orleans already owes Mark Ingram $3.7 million in 2017, and the former Alabama star is likely to keep his starting job whether Peterson joins the team or not. That means Peterson would essentially be a backup if he joined the Saints, so he can’t expect to be paid like a starter.

Peterson recently turned 32 and is coming off another significant knee injury, so his stock isn’t exactly at its peak. Teams have also been wary of the child abuse scandal that caused him to miss nearly the entire 2014 season, though there have been indications that A.P. appears to be in great physical condition.

If a team wanted Peterson as a starter, he probably would have been signed by now. He’ll likely find work at some point after the NFL Draft.
